Draining the refrigerant circuit
Draining the refrigerant circuit
Refrigerant must not be allowed to escape into the environment, it should be extracted from the refrigerant circuit by means of a suction unit or service station. The refrigerant removed should then be re-processed on site or returned to the manufacturer for proper disposal (different or additional regulations may apply in other countries). Therefore, vehicles have to be taken to a specialist air conditioning workshop (which will have the necessary equipment and tools).
Reason:
Should it escape into the earth's atmosphere, refrigerant R134a will have a detrimental effect in terms of global warming.
  Note
t  The greenhouse effect of refrigerant R134a is much less than that of refrigerant R12.
t  Refrigerant R134a does not affect the ozone layer in the earth's atmosphere. (R134a is an HFC and does not possess any atoms of chlorine). The depletion of the ozone in the upper atmosphere is only caused by the splitting of carbon-chlorine bonds (as is the case, for example, with the refrigerant R12).
After draining the air conditioning system, unplug the connector from the air conditioner compressor regulating valve -N280- or from the high-pressure sender -G65-.
Reason:
The air conditioner compressor regulating valve -N280- is then no longer actuated and the compressor runs at idle. The compressor is designed such that the lubrication of the compressor components is ensured by way of an internal oil circuit at idle (provided there is sufficient refrigerant oil in the compressor).
